Family roles: how not to get confused about who is who

Family roles: how not to get confused about who is who

In a modern family, gradually moving away from traditional models, it is easy to get confused in understanding who expects what from whom and who can be counted on and in what.

The question arises, how to create and maintain effective, harmonious functioning of the family, when each family member understands their function, task and responsibility?

Distribution of roles helps to create consistency and interaction within the family.

When everyone knows their responsibilities, the likelihood of conflicts decreases and the effectiveness of family tasks increases.

Establishing clear roles helps children understand the expectations and structure of family life, which contributes to their development and upbringing.

A well-thought-out and balanced distribution of roles plays an important role in creating a healthy and harmonious atmosphere, where everyone can feel important and respected.
